When it’s lights off, it’s game on with the ProjeX™ Projecting Gaming Arcade from New York City-based NSI International, Inc. Projex lets you blast targets, ducks or UFOs that are projected right onto your wall – each with its own unique sound effects.

ProjeX turns any room in your house into an incredible gaming arcade. The Projex system projects the targets onto almost any wall.  There’s no need for a TV, computer, smart phone or other equipment. The size of your wall is essentially the limit to the size of your play area. Projex works best in a dark room, when you project on a light-colored wall with no artwork, wallpaper or painted patterns. 

The portable, battery-operated projector includes two blasters, which are stored right on the unit, a built-in LED scoreboard, and a place to keep image slides.

ProjeX is battery-powered so it can go wherever you go – inside or out. Play on any blank wall, your garage door – even the side of your house.  It really is a very unique gaming experience.

There are 5 different built-in games test your speed and skill, as well as 3 skill levels – beginner, advanced and expert (The “beginner” setting accommodates even the youngest players in the room.) It comes with 3 interchangeable image slides. You can blast ducks, targets or UFOs – each with its own unique sound effects. You change slides to change your level of difficulty:

    • Blue (targets) = easy
    • Red (UFOs) = medium
    • White (ducks) = difficult

You can play solo, head to head, or “co op”, where 2 players team up to combine scores. There are also tournaments. If you are playing alone, you can still work on your own score. You can play outside at night as well, on your house or even your garage door.

SET UP
  1. Install three BRAND NEW, FRESH “AA” alkaline batteries.
  1. Set ProjeX on a low table, with the projector aimed at the wall. The projector should be 5 feet from the wall.
  1. Slide an image slide into the image slot, rounded side up (if it doesn’t fit, it’s backwards).  Blue = easy, red = medium, white = difficult
  1. Plug in both blasters.  Then, if you’re playing solo, unplug one.
  1. Press the red power button. You have 45 seconds to adjust the focus.
  1. Press the red button again to select game 1-5.
  1. Press the blue button to select your level – beginner, advanced or expert.
  1. To start playing solo or head-to-head, load your blaster by sliding the button on the top. Each reload gives you 6 shots. You can reload at any time.
  1. To start a Co-Op game, where you combine your scores, both players must hold the trigger while they reload.
